Are you passionate about data integrity? Do you want to be at the heart of a renowned institution's fundraising and alumni relations efforts?

The University of Cambridge Development and Alumni Relations is seeking a new Data Quality Coordinator to join our dynamic Prospect Development team. In this role, you will be responsible for our quality of data, ensuring that the information we rely on is precise and effective in driving our fundraising and alumni engagement initiatives.

As the Data Quality Coordinator, you will take a proactive approach in maintaining and enhancing the data managed by both the Prospect Development and Gift and Data Services teams using our Amicus database. Amicus supports over 300 development staff across the University, its Colleges, and Cambridge in America, making your role crucial to our operational success.

Key responsibilities include:

Overseeing and aligning regular data quality tasks and strategic data quality projects across various teams, including Prospect Management and Business Intelligence, Development Research and Due Diligence, Settlement, and Gift and Data Operations.

Supporting these teams to ensure their data quality processes are robust, consistently followed, and improved when necessary.

Playing a strategic role in preparing for future fundraising campaigns or system migrations, ensuring our data quality remains at the highest standards.

This role is based within the Prospect Development team but is designed for cross-functional collaboration with the Gift and Data Services teams and the Information Services team. Reporting directly to the Prospect Management and Business Intelligence Manager, you will be instrumental in driving data quality.
